[0001] This utility model relates to the field of silicone rubber production technology, and in particular to a small bag precipitated silica feeding device. Background Technology

[0002] In the processing of polymer materials such as rubber, plastics, and coatings, precipitated silica is an important reinforcing agent, thickener, and matting agent. The efficiency and cleanliness of its feeding process directly affect the stability of subsequent production processes and product quality. Currently, for precipitated silica packaged in 15kg bags, the industry generally uses manual feeding to feed it into kneaders or powder storage tanks. This process requires a simple operating table or is carried out directly at the equipment's feed inlet.

[0003] Precipitated silica has physical characteristics such as small particle size, large specific surface area, poor flowability, and easy dust generation. Direct feeding at the equipment's feeding port will cause dust pollution, which is easily inhaled and seriously affects the health of operators. Therefore, a dust-free feeding station is used for feeding. The structure of a dust-free feeding station currently in use is as disclosed in CN202223544493.4. It includes a main hopper with a discharge port and a feeding port. The main hopper is provided with a door at the feeding port. The top of the door is hinged to the main hopper. The key feature is that a gas spring is provided between the door and the main hopper, and the gas spring includes a telescopically connected cylinder and a piston rod. The end of the cylinder away from the piston rod is hinged to the main hopper, and the end of the piston rod away from the cylinder is hinged to the door. When feeding or unloading materials, the silo door is opened upwards and supported by a gas spring. Simultaneously, the blower is activated. Workers pour materials from the feeding port towards the internal inlet. The material enters through the inlet and exits through the bottom outlet for subsequent production needs. Dust generated during this process is sucked away by the blower and filtered through the filter element, reducing dust emissions. When cleaning the filter element after long-term use, the silo door is closed, and high-pressure air is introduced into the pulse air pipe to backflushing the filter element, removing dust adhering to it. This process cleans the filter element while simultaneously recycling some materials, reducing waste.

[0004] However, while 15kg pouches are convenient for manual handling, the raw materials tend to adhere to the inner wall of the pouch and accumulate at the opening during feeding, resulting in a slow natural descent. To speed up the feeding process, operators need to repeatedly shake the pouches up and down. However, due to the limited size of the feeding station, the feeding space is usually quite small, making it difficult to fully utilize the shaking action. This not only consumes a lot of physical strength but also severely restricts production efficiency. Summary of the Invention

[0022] like Figure 1-4 As shown, a small bag precipitated silica feeding device includes:

[0023] The base frame includes a support frame 1 and a top plate 2 fixedly installed on the support frame. A hopper 3 is fixedly installed downward on the top plate, and an electric valve 4 is installed at the lower end of the hopper.

[0024] The feeding bin 5 is fixedly installed on the top plate. A feeding port is provided on one side of the feeding bin. A bin door 6 is provided at the feeding port. The upper end of the bin door is hinged to the feeding bin. Two glove openings are provided on the bin door. Sealing gloves 7 are sealed to the glove openings. An elastic feeding structure is provided inside the feeding bin.

[0025] A filter chamber 8 is fixedly installed above the feeding chamber. A centrifugal fan 9 is installed on the filter chamber, and the air inlet of the centrifugal fan is connected to the inside of the filter chamber. A filter element 10 is installed inside the filter chamber, and the lower end of the filter element passes through the filter chamber and enters the feeding chamber. A pulse air pipe 11 is connected to the filter chamber. The air outlet of the pulse air pipe is located between the filter element and the centrifugal fan. A pulse valve 12 is provided on the pulse air pipe, and the air inlet of the pulse air pipe is connected to a high-pressure air source 13.

[0026] Thus, when feeding 15kg bags of precipitated silica, open the hopper door, place the bag containing the 15kg bag of precipitated silica through the feeding port onto the flexible feeding structure, cut open the bottom of the bag with a knife, then close the hopper door. The operator puts on sealed gloves and operates the flexible feeding structure to quickly feed the precipitated silica from the bag. If there is little material remaining, the bag can be shaken by hand to ensure all 15kg of precipitated silica enters the hopper. Alternatively, a knife can be placed inside the feeding hopper. After placing the 15kg bag of precipitated silica through the feeding port onto the flexible feeding structure, close the hopper door, put on sealed gloves, cut open the bag with the knife, and then operate the flexible feeding structure. The upper opening of the hopper is located inside the hopper. The sealed glove design of the feeding hopper allows operators to complete the feeding operation while isolated from the external environment. During operation, the centrifugal fan starts, creating a negative pressure environment in both the filter and feeding hoppers, effectively suppressing dust spillage. The flexible feeding structure assists in the detachment of 15kg bags of precipitated silica from the packaging, solving the problem of inconvenience caused by the size limitation of the feeding hopper when manually shaking the packaging bags. The combination of the filter element and the pulse system prevents precipitated silica from entering the fan, while pulse backflushing achieves self-cleaning of the filter element, ensuring efficient exhaust ventilation. The overall structure solves the problems of dust pollution, time-consuming and labor-intensive operation, and inconvenience of traditional manual feeding, achieving a clean and efficient feeding process.

[0027] In implementation, the two sides of the hopper door are connected to the hopper via gas springs 14. Each gas spring includes a telescopically connected cylinder and a piston rod. The end of the cylinder away from the piston rod is hinged to the feeding hopper, and the end of the piston rod away from the cylinder is hinged to the hopper door. The design of the gas springs on both sides of the hopper door allows it to remain stable after opening, requiring no manual support and facilitating quick loading and unloading of packaging bags by operators. When closing, the cushioning effect of the gas springs prevents the hopper door from colliding with the feeding hopper, thus avoiding sealing failure or structural damage.

[0028] Of course, in actual implementation, the bottom of the filter element is set higher than the feeding port to avoid interference between the operator and the filter element when the operator is feeding the material at the feeding port. This ensures the operating space and prevents the filter element from being damaged by contact or collision. In addition, this layout brings the filter element closer to the centrifugal fan's air intake, optimizes the airflow path, improves filtration and ventilation efficiency, and ensures stable negative pressure in the feeding hopper.

[0029] In implementation, the elastic feeding structure includes a support ring 15, within which several spaced grid bars 16 are fixed. The lower end of the support ring is circumferentially connected to a top plate via several compression springs 17. A 15kg bag of precipitated silica is placed on the grid bars for support, preventing it from falling into the hopper. During feeding, the operator wears sealed gloves and repeatedly presses the support ring, causing it to oscillate up and down. The elasticity of the compression springs generates a counter-force when the operator presses the bag, aiding in the loosening and falling of the powder inside. This reduces the force and frequency of manual shaking, occupies little space, and is labor-saving and easy to use. The precipitated silica falls through the gaps between adjacent grid bars.

[0030] In implementation, the inner ring 18 is fixedly installed downwards on the support ring. The upper end of the hopper is cylindrical and the lower end is conical. The outer side of the inner ring is slidably engaged with the upper end of the hopper. The inner ring, which slides with the hopper, guides the up-and-down elastic movement of the support ring, preventing tilting of the support ring due to uneven force on the compression spring and ensuring structural stability. The inner ring faces the hopper, reducing dust dispersion during powder descent and allowing for better powder entry into the hopper.

[0031] In implementation, several guide posts 19 are fixedly installed downwards on the support ring. The guide posts pass through compression springs, and several sliding holes are provided on the top plate. The guide posts slide in conjunction with the sliding holes, providing guidance for the movement of the support ring.

[0032] The small-bag precipitated silica feeding device provided in this application achieves closed and efficient feeding of 15Kg small bags of powder through the synergistic effect of its various structural components: the closed feeding hopper and negative pressure system solve the dust pollution problem, protect the health of operators and reduce raw material waste; the flexible feeding structure, combined with sealed gloves, significantly reduces the intensity of manual labor and shortens the feeding time per bag; the pulse filtration system ensures long-term stable operation of the equipment, reduces maintenance costs, and as a whole meets the clean, efficient and safe requirements of kneaders or powder storage tanks for feeding small-bag precipitated silica.

[0034] principle:

[0035] During operation, the operator opens the silo door and places a 15kg bag of precipitated silica onto the support ring through the feeding port, using the grid bars for support. The silo door is then closed, and the centrifugal fan is started via the PLC controller. The operator, wearing sealed gloves, uses a knife to cut open the bag. The support ring is then pressed and released, causing it to move upwards under the force of the compression spring. Repeating this pressing and releasing creates an up-and-down oscillating motion, accelerating the transfer of the precipitated silica from the bag into the hopper. Throughout this process, the centrifugal fan creates a negative pressure environment in both the filter and feeding silos, preventing dust spillage. After feeding is complete, the centrifugal fan is stopped via the PLC controller. The filter element and pulse system work together to prevent precipitated silica from entering the centrifugal fan. When cleaning the filter element, a high-flow pulse jet is used to backflush it, ensuring timely cleaning. The silo door remains closed during filter element cleaning. The high-pressure air source connected to the pulse air tube can be a high-pressure air tank or a high-pressure air bag.
